Flashed My ECU

scott at softronic told me that since i had bought his program for the boxsterS recently he would swap me for the program for my C4S at no charge since they are the same price. all he asked is that i flashed the boxster back to stock before trading-in. no problem, i was gonna do that anyway.

flashed the boxster to stock. brought home the C4S. read the original program and sent it to scott over internet. next day he sent me my tuned ECU program which i flashed into my ECU through the OBDII port.

throttle response is better. low and mid-range torque is noticeably higher. power comes on less peaky. should work nicely with planned mods...

Originally Posted by YoopsRacing
looks interesting...any comparison test on Softronic vs Revo vs Giac vs FVD?
only on paper:

S/W HP TQ $$$$
FVD 10 11 1295
GIAC 10-20 10-15 995
REVO 10-20 12-18 899
softronic 20 13 895

this is information gathered from public web sites.

I added the Softronic tune last year (Scott's a great guy, and very patient I might add) along with the RSS plenum and the Schnell straight tube intake. Together these made a nice difference - sharper throttle response, no flat spots, car feels quicker (subjective I realize) and pulls stronger. Doesn't turn the car into a TT, but I like the extra grunt and I'm happy with these mods.
